      Also can you help me understand how hsv-1g is normally transferred. If I am understanding correctly, it is highly unusual to get hsv1 through genital to genital sex.

      1. So, girls get it from oral sex from a hsv1 – oral positive guy?
      2. And guys most likely get it from oral sex from a girl who is hsv1 oral
      Positive?
      I read on another site a doctor said he has never seen hsv1 transferred Genital to Genital even though it’s possible.
      3. I am hsv1 g– so safe to give oral sex?
      4. More risky receiving oral sex – could give it him?
      5. And very low risk with regular sex?

    • July 19, 2015 at 2:09 pm #8234
      Terri Warren
      Keymaster

      1. HSV 1 is usually transmitted via oral sex, yes. so the answer to this question is yes.
      2. Yes
      3. I have seen HSV 1 transmitted via intercourse, though it is less likely but I have seen it before, certainly
      4. You could give it to a male partner who is giving you oral sex but remember that HSV 1 genitally sheds far less often than HSV 2 genitally, so it is less likely to be transmitted either through intercourse or someone giving you oral sex.
      5. Yes, low risk with intercourse. The risk is higher in the first year or so of having herpes because the immune system has not yet become skilled at dealing with herpes.
